SUNDAY TALK SHOW RATINGS ANALYSIS

Nielsen Media Research ratings composite for Sunday, December 2, 2007
PROGRAM
VIEWERS
CHG
NBC MEET THE PRESS
 4,390,000
 +338,000
CBS FACE THE NATION
 2,562,000
 +206,000
ABC THIS WEEK
 2,905,000
 +250,000
FOX NEWS SUNDAY
 2,015,000
 -241,000
CNN LATE EDITION
   476,000
 -101,000
All in all, last week's batch of numbers was a decidedly "up" week for the Sunday shows, which means it's probably a blip on the Nielsen measuring system and will likely return down again for this week's shows. Meet the Press continues a completely inexplicable rally and has risen over a million viewers in a month and a half. Face the Nation and This Week both saw significant gains as well. The big loser this week is Fox News Sunday, who lost about 10% of its audience after the "Fred bump" last week. Given that this is an "up week" and that the MSM claims Fred is losing ground, I have reason to believe given the performance on Fox, that they're incorrect.
Data derived from Nielsen Media Research ratings for live broadcasts as publicized by numerous Web resources. Numbers for Fox News Sunday and Meet the Press include numbers from prime time replays on Fox News Channel and MSNBC, respectively. All numbers (c)2007 Nielsen Media Research.

Thanks anita. Did you see this jewel? This was on page A-4 of the Austin paper today. I didn't see it posted on FR today yet.

From the article:

For more than an hour, the bipartisan group, which included current House Speaker Nancy Pelosi (D-Calif.), was given a virtual tour of the CIA's overseas detention sites and the harsh techniques interrogators had devised to try to make their prisoners talk.

Among the techniques described, said two officials present, was waterboarding, a practice that years later would be condemned as torture by Democrats and some Republicans on Capitol Hill. But on that day, no objections were raised. Instead, at least two lawmakers in the room asked the CIA to push harder, two U.S. officials said.

Lawmakers Briefed on Waterboarding in 2002
